   This fifth patch rewrites lttng-ctl's set_session_daemon_path() to avoid duplicating snippets of code.  It also fixes the snprintf return value test so the code works with both GNU C < 2.1 and >= 2.1.  With GNU C < 2.1, snprintf returns -1 if the target buffer is too small; with GNU C >= 2.1, snprintf returns the required size (excluding the closing null) under the same conditions.

   I do believe it is functionally identical to the version it replaces, but someone should check to make sure.   :-)

diff --git a/lttng2-lttng-tools-2.0-pre18+-5c73c59/src/lib/lttng-ctl/lttng-ctl.c b/lttng2-lttng-tools-2.0-pre18+-5c73c59/src/lib/lttng-ctl/lttng-ctl.c
index 537934f..65aa3e3 100644
--- a/lttng2-lttng-tools-2.0-pre18+-5c73c59/src/lib/lttng-ctl/lttng-ctl.c
+++ b/lttng2-lttng-tools-2.0-pre18+-5c73c59/src/lib/lttng-ctl/lttng-ctl.c
@@ -228,35 +228,31 @@
 		in_tgroup = check_tracing_group(tracing_group);
 	}
 
-	if (uid == 0) {
-		/* Root */
+	if ((uid == 0) || in_tgroup) {
 		copy_string(sessiond_sock_path,
 				DEFAULT_GLOBAL_CLIENT_UNIX_SOCK,
 				sizeof(sessiond_sock_path));
-	} else if (in_tgroup) {
-		/* Tracing group */
-		copy_string(sessiond_sock_path,
-				DEFAULT_GLOBAL_CLIENT_UNIX_SOCK,
-				sizeof(sessiond_sock_path));
-
-		ret = try_connect_sessiond(sessiond_sock_path);
-		if (ret < 0) {
-			/* Global session daemon not available */
-			if (snprintf(sessiond_sock_path, sizeof(sessiond_sock_path),
-						DEFAULT_HOME_CLIENT_UNIX_SOCK,
-						getenv("HOME")) < 0) {
-				return -ENOMEM;
-			}
 		}
-	} else {
-		/* Not in tracing group and not root, default */
-		if (snprintf(sessiond_sock_path, PATH_MAX,
-					DEFAULT_HOME_CLIENT_UNIX_SOCK,
-					getenv("HOME")) < 0) {
+	if (uid != 0) {
+		if (in_tgroup) {
+			/* Tracing group */
+			ret = try_connect_sessiond(sessiond_sock_path);
+			if (ret >= 0) goto end;
+			/* Global session daemon not available... */
+		}
+		/* ...or not in tracing group (and not root), default */
+		/*
+		 * With GNU C <  2.1, snprintf returns -1 if the target buffer is too small;
+		 * With GNU C >= 2.1, snprintf returns the required size (excluding closing null)
+		 */
+		ret = snprintf(sessiond_sock_path, sizeof(sessiond_sock_path),
+				DEFAULT_HOME_CLIENT_UNIX_SOCK,
+				getenv("HOME"));
+		if ((ret < 0) || (ret >= sizeof(sessiond_sock_path))) {
 			return -ENOMEM;
 		}
 	}
-
+end:
 	return 0;
 }
